At least 27 people died in Nepal on Friday when a tour bus fell into a gorge and went into the Marsyangdi River in the central district of Tanahun.
The bus, carrying tourists from Maharashtra State in the center-west of India, was en route to Nepal’s capital, Kathmandu, from Pokhara, a popular tourist destination. Nepal gets a lot of Indian tourists, mostly families who arrive by road to visit major Hindu temples.
The cause of the accident was not immediately clear.
